One way to bring a hint of traditional French flair to the outside of your house is by playing with different textures. Layered linens are always a great way to do this, especially for windows and doorways. Thickly woven shutters in muted hues like deep blacks or navy blues can really create an old-world feel, as can window boxes filled with trailing ivy and lacy curtains. Without going too over the top, you can easily capture the essence of French architecture with subtle touches.
